And last year, he had a no movement clause. This year, he doesn’t. his contract. Obviously, the last two years of his contract, he has a modified no trade list, so he can be traded now to a certain number of teams. So, I think Doug Armstrong is working the phones. If you look at Jordan Cyro, it does actually make sense on paper that he wouldn’t be the first out of the door simply because of his contract and that he has a no movement clause now. So, this does make sense on paper that it could be Braden Shen that’s on the way out first. He has term, which a lot of GMs want. His cap hit is relatively low considering the salary cap is going up at only $6.5 million. He is a center very, you know, those are wanted around the league right now. There’s a high demand for those. Uh he’s a center who’s won the Stanley Cup. He’s the captain of this team.
